One of the best things that ever happened in Ireland was the introduction of the plastic bag ‘tax’ a few years ago.  I’m writing about this now as a similar tax has come into operation in England this week.

Here in Ireland, we’ve pretty much got rid of the blight of plastic bags being blown all over the countryside and finding themselves knotted around branches, stuck in stone walls, floating down rivers and being washed up all along our lovely coastline.

Plastic bags have a value now and having a value is something that is hugely important in all walks of life.

Fight for Rhinos spends all monetary donations on our conservation projects. But there is a definite need for other items and services:

  • a new color printer
  • printing services (flyers, posters, etc.)
  •  t-shirt donations (for printing)
  • US screenprinting services
  • US volunteer grant-writers
  • volunteers

If you are able to assist us in any way with our wishlist, or have any questions, please email us directly at fightforrhinos@gmail.com

Remember we are a registered non-profit and items donated may be tax-deductible.
